Output 51053c6fe75264b44a439fe19e18ce3ec72711ec79d2552dde501516f65241d5:0

value
147669758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c608984a08e2bf75ae7a26d1520ab76eaa9d6c47 OP_EQUAL
address
3Kk81i4wtzXUaiSjfbcsnm7hKnfjWrjZgY
transaction
51053c6fe75264b44a439fe19e18ce3ec72711ec79d2552dde501516f65241d5
spent
true